Sparta defeated Hradec thanks to an excellent second half. Pešek scored twice

The Sparta footballers defeated the newcomer from Hradec Králové 4: 0 in the fifth round of the first league and returned to the top of the incomplete table by a point ahead of Pilsen. The Prague team decided to win in the second half. Gradually, Adam Hložek, Jakub Pešek, Matěj Polidar and, in the end, Pešek again prevailed.

Coach Pavel Vrba’s charges did not lose 14 consecutive matches in the highest competition and won nine of the last ten. The Spartans defeated the league in the East Bohemia for the seventh time in a row and defeated them in Letná in the 15th duel of the highest competition. The “Slaves” are still waiting for the first win of the league season.

Eight minutes after the change of sides, the home team opened the score. Wiesner passed into the penalty area to Hložek, who did not give Fendrich a chance with a cannonball under the crossbar. “Even during the break, we believed that Hradec could not sustain such a style of the whole match. We are used to such matches, we pushed for them and in the end it fell there,” the club website Hložka was quoted as saying.

Immediately afterwards, Karabec headed up close outside the three sticks. Fendrich pulled Hanck’s shot from a distance. In the 66th minute, the Spartans added a fuse when Pešek headed for the far post in the lime after Hložek’s pass. Five minutes later, Fendrich fired Sáček’s shot only at the quick-ending Polidar.

Another shot could have been added by Karlsson, but his shot ended up next. Pešek determined the final result with a ground shot from lime. Sparta pod Vrbou also won the 11th home league match, in which it scored 41 goals. Hradec did not win the highest competition outside for the sixth time in a row.

“Sparta’s victory is deserved, of course. Maybe the above is a bit cruel for us, because we gave a nice performance from my point of view. There was a huge difference in the quality of the final phase of the teams. the leading team of the league, “said guest coach Miroslav Koubek.
